When operating normally, the light rail now goes directly to Penn Station again. However, it is currently out of service between North Ave and Camden because of the fire on Howard Street earlier this week. The service alerts are set for 24 hours but so far each day they've updated the alert to extend it, so no real answer about when normal service will resume. Check the MTA website tomorrow. If it's normal you can just take the LR all the way to Penn (though I think you'll have to make sure you get on one of the trains that stops there, because not all do). If it's still suspended you'll have to stop at North Ave and take the bus or walk to Penn from there. Personally I'd walk unless I'm carrying a lot of luggage, it'll be about 15 minutes. The bike route has rolling outages I believe, the cyclists will mostly be in pretty tight packs and there will be officials at cross streets to signal when traffic and pedestrians can go through. So I would plan to be there super early in case you get caught waiting for the cyclists to go by.

It might be simpler to just take the bus in from the County, there are several that will drop you by Penn. However, you'll also have to check the MTA website to see how those routes might be affected. Generally the MTA service alerts are the best source of information in cases like this.
